The kids of lunch visitors who died after being served pork wellington by way of Erin Patterson have given proof at her triple homicide trial.
Anna Terrington and Matthew Patterson, the youngsters of Don and Gail Patterson, and Ruth Dubois, the daughter of Heather and Ian Wilkinson, had been referred to as as witnesses on Wednesday in Victoria’s excellent courtroom, sitting on the Latrobe Valley legislation courts in Morwell.
Patterson, 50, faces 3 fees of homicide and one rate of tried homicide on the subject of the lunch she served at her space in Leongatha on 29 July 2023.
She has pleaded no longer to blame to murdering or making an attempt to homicide the relations of her estranged husband, Simon Patterson.
She is accused of murdering Simon’s folks, Don and Gail Patterson, his aunt Heather Wilkinson, and making an attempt to homicide Ian Wilkinson, Simon’s uncle and Heather’s husband.
Terrington, Don and Gail’s youngest kid, advised the courtroom she had identified Patterson because the accused and Simon began a dating in about 2005.
She agreed that her folks had maintained a excellent dating with Patterson in spite of her setting apart from Simon in 2015.

Terrington additionally agreed, underneath cross-examination from Sophie Stafford, for Patterson, that they’d been supportive of her and there was once no animosity between them.
About 5pm at the day of the lunch, about two hours after her folks returned house, Terrington spoke to her mom.
“Mum said it went well,” Terrington, who become emotional throughout her proof, advised the courtroom.
“She said that they had beef wellington and that it was too much for mum, so dad finished hers.”
Terrington agreed that Patterson and Simon had loaned her and her husband about $400,000, and that she were shut with Patterson throughout considered one of their pregnancies.
These pregnancies ended in them having kids 3 days aside who become identified within the circle of relatives as “the twins”, the courtroom heard.
Matthew Patterson, a church pastor, additionally agreed that his folks had a good dating with Patterson, which remained the “status quo” even after her separation from Simon.
He advised the courtroom a couple of lunch in 2021 when Patterson advised him she was once unhappy the connection was once “unable to move forward”, and she or he requested him for recommendation about how one can get Simon to participate in counselling on the subject of the wedding.
Matthew stated it gave the impression that the communique between Simon and Patterson had transform extra “mechanical” in later years, and that she had attended fewer circle of relatives occasions, however stated that can had been as a result of Covid-19 made such occasions much less common.
Dubois, who stated in courtroom that she simplest regarded as herself an acquaintance of Patterson, expressed wonder when her mom, Heather Wilkinson, advised her she were invited to lunch.
Patterson had come throughout Heather and Gail after a sermon on the Korumburra Baptist church, the place Ian was once a pastor, 13 days prior to the lunch.
Dubois stated her mom had advised her Patterson stated to them after the sermon “just the two I was looking for” and invited them for lunch.
Her mom had stated, after Dubois expressed wonder on the invitation, “Yes, we were surprised also, that had never happened before.”
The courtroom additionally heard from scientific witnesses concerning the remedy equipped to the lunch visitors, and a seek of the Victorian most cancers registry, which showed that Patterson had by no means been recognized with most cancers.
The courtroom has in the past heard Patterson advised her lunch visitors that she had most cancers however her legal professionals advised the courtroom it was once stated she had by no means been recognized.
